Abstract

The deployment of wireless ad-hoc mobile sensor network (MASNET) technology proves critical in many civilian and military applications. Routing over MASNET faces many challenges, such as scarce bandwidth, dynamic change of topology, limited computational capabilities, and power budgets of sensor nodes. Hence, we introduced a new routeless routing model that efficiently copes with such challenges, as asserted by initial simulation-obtained results. In this paper we validate our routing protocol via both mathematical modeling and simulation.
